"Goodbye Mr A" is the second single by British pop rock band The Hoosiers from their debut album The Trick to Life. It was released on 8 October 2007. The song, which is written in the key of B major, was written in memory of frontman Irwin Sparkes' secondary school English teacher, Jonathan "Mr. A" Anderton. Sparkes said he was inspired to write the song upon hearing of Anderton's death in 2006.
